A Star is Born: Judy Garland's Rise to Fame
Born Frances Ethel Gumm on June 10, 1922, in Grand Rapids, Minnesota, Judy Garland would grow up to become one of the most beloved and influential figures in show business. Her journey to stardom began in her childhood, performing in her family's vaudeville act alongside her sisters, The Gumm Sisters. It wasn't long before she caught the attention of Hollywood bigwigs, and by the age of 13, she had signed her first contract with Metro-Goldwyn-Mayer (MGM).
Judy's breakthrough role came in 1939 with her portrayal of Dorothy Gale in The Wizard of Oz. This classic film would not only cement her status as a Hollywood icon but also provide her with one of her most enduring and beloved performances. Throughout her career, Judy would go on to star in numerous films, including Meet Me in St. Louis, Easter Parade, and A Star is Born, among many others. Her incredible talent and captivating presence made her a true Hollywood powerhouse.
The Ups and Downs of Judy Garland's Career
While Judy's career was marked by immense success, it was also fraught with challenges and struggles. Her demanding studio bosses at MGM, particularly Louis B. Mayer, pushed her relentlessly, often leading to grueling work schedules and intense pressure. This, coupled with her personal struggles with mental health and substance abuse, made for a complex and often tumultuous life.
Despite these obstacles, Judy continued to shine on screen, captivating audiences with her powerful performances and unforgettable songs. Her extraordinary talent and resilience in the face of adversity have made her a true inspiration to generations of entertainers and fans alike.
Judy Garland's Net Worth: A Closer Look
Now, let's get down to business and talk about Judy Garland's net worth. It's important to note that determining the exact net worth of a historical figure like Judy can be quite challenging, as many factors must be taken into account, including inflation, the value of her assets over time, and the fluctuations of the entertainment industry. However, we can make some educated estimates based on the available information.
Throughout her career, Judy Garland earned a considerable amount of money from her film and stage work. According to some sources, she earned around $1.5 million from her films alone, which, when adjusted for inflation, amounts to approximately $25 million in today's dollars. Additionally, she had successful concert tours and appearances on television, which added to her overall earnings.
However, it's essential to remember that Judy's struggles with substance abuse and financial mismanagement led to significant financial losses throughout her life. She was known to be quite generous with her money, often lending large sums to friends and family without expecting repayment. Furthermore, her legal battles and court cases, stemming from disputes with her studio and various business partners, also took a toll on her financial situation.
Taking these factors into account, it's challenging to pinpoint an exact Judy Garland net worth figure. While some sources estimate her net worth to be around $20 million at the time of her death, it's essential to consider that this is a rough estimate and that the true figure may have been lower due to her financial struggles and generosity.

The Judy Garland Effect: Her Influence on Pop Culture
Judy Garland's influence can be seen throughout popular culture, from music and film to fashion and beyond. Her iconic roles, such as Dorothy Gale in The Wizard of Oz and Esther Smith in Meet Me in St. Louis, have become beloved classics, inspiring countless adaptations, homages, and parodies.
Her timeless songs, like "Over the Rainbow" and "Get Happy," have become standards, recorded by countless artists and remaining as popular today as they were when she first sang them. Judy's unique sense of style, characterized by her signature curls, dramatic makeup, and glamorous gowns, has also left a lasting impact on fashion, inspiring designers and trendsetters for generations.
Moreover, Judy's openness about her struggles with mental health and substance abuse has paved the way for future generations of entertainers to discuss their own challenges candidly. Her courage in the face of adversity has served as an inspiration to countless individuals, reminding us all that it's okay to be vulnerable and seek help when we need it.
The Judy Garland Museum: Preserving Her Legacy
To honor Judy Garland's incredible life and career, the Judy Garland Museum was established in her hometown of Grand Rapids, Minnesota. The museum is dedicated to preserving and celebrating her legacy, showcasing an extensive collection of artifacts, costumes, and memorabilia from her extraordinary life and career.
Visitors can explore exhibits dedicated to various aspects of Judy's life, from her childhood and early career to her iconic film roles and her influence on popular culture. The museum also hosts events and programs throughout the year, including the annual Judy Garland Festival, which celebrates her life and work with performances, screenings, and other special events.
The Judy Garland Museum serves as a testament to the enduring impact of this remarkable woman, ensuring that her story and legacy continue to inspire and captivate fans for generations to come.
